Detailsinfo

A vulnerability classified as critical was found in MediaWiki up to 1.27.0 (Content Management System). Affected by this vulnerability is the function Session::getAllowedUserRights of the component Access Restriction.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a access control v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-284. The product does not restrict or incorrectly restricts access to a resource from an unauthorized actor.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:

MediaWiki 1.27.x before 1.27.1 might allow remote attackers to bypass intended session access restrictions by leveraging a call to the UserGetRights function after Session::getAllowedUserRights.

The bug was discovered 04/20/2017. The weakness was shared 04/20/2017 (Website). The advisory is shared at lists.wikimedia.org.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2016-6337 since 07/26/2016.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ploitation doesn't need any form of authentication. It demands that the victim is doing some kind of user interaction.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available. MITRE ATT&CK project uses the attack technique T1068 for this issue.

The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 93195 (MediaWiki 1.23.x < 1.23.15 / 1.26.x < 1.26.4 / 1.27.x < 1.27.1 Multiple Vulnerabilities),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family CGI abuses and running in the context r.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 11684 (Mediawiki Multiple Vulnerabilities (MediaWiki Security Release: 1.27.1, 1.26.4, 1.23.15)).

Upgrading to version 1.27.1 e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published before and not just after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
